Tsunami warning after strong earthquake off New Caledonia

Remove

A strong earthquake has occurred south of the New Caledonia archipelago, approximately 1000 kilometers east of Australia.

The earthquake has been measured at magnitude 7.6.

A tsunami warning has now been issued and authorities are urging residents to take shelter.

Dangerous waves cannot be ruled out in the western Pacific Ocean, after a large earthquake near New Caledonia, writes the tsunami center PTWC.

”"A tsunami threat exists for parts of the Pacific Ocean near the earthquake," writes PTWC.
The earthquake that occurred early Wednesday morning, Swedish time, had a preliminary magnitude of 7.6, and was centered at a depth of ten kilometers approximately 30 nautical miles east of New Caledonia's capital, Noumea, writes the US seismic agency USGS.

Authorities are now urging residents to seek shelter.
The island group of New Caledonia is a French territory and as recently as a month ago the inhabitants voted against independence from France. Just over a quarter of a million people live on New Caledonia.
